So the full list of SXSW bands has been released. It’s a little dizzying to look at such a long list—it’s even worse in person with a half dozen Lone Stars in your belly—of performers, but this year’s festival looks pretty impressive.

Included in this endless parade of performing acts are a whole lot of Portland bands.

They are (in alphabetical order):
A Weather / Blitzen Trapper / The Blow / The Builders and The Butchers / Castanets / Eat Skull / Laura Gibson / The Helio Sequence / Kaddisfly / Lifesavas / Little Claw / New Bloods / Old Time Relijun / Panther / Red Fang / Sleep / To Live and Die in LA / Valet / White Rainbow / YACHT / Larry Yes

This is more than last year (I believe it was 17 last year), and there just might be more local bands added as the festival draws closer.
